i just bought one off GunBroker (9mm) -- supposed to be delivered to my FFL today. I'll know after I put a couple of thousand rounds through it whether or not it's gonna qualify as a BUG for me. Lasers ??? Unless you have a vision problem that prevents your seeing the sights, I think lasers serve as a well-marketed crutch that will usually impede one's target acquisition and rate of fire. I do have a couple of friends (one a retired State Trooper with a lot of experience in their SWAT unit and as a firearms instructor for LSP) who is close to having to go to a RDS for his carry gun. This isn't something he'll do until he absolutely has to -- cause "iron sights" are faster. And iron sights don't have batteries that might die just before you do. For people who have really poor but correctable (with glasses or contacts) vision, one could make the case for having a laser as a "back-up" sight system for "middle of the night, don't have time to put in my contacts" scenario. But even then, gaining competency with the "iron sights" should be a higher priority.
